Why are hotel check-ins so late?

The more time allotted, the fewer maids needed. That translates into less cost per room to the hotel. Check ins at hotels are typically late because it takes time for the hotel staff to prepare a room for the next guest.


Why is checkout at 11?

In between check out and check in the cleaning staff needs tome to prepare the room for the next customer. So in between they can clean the rooms. They count on a certain percentage to leave before say 11 am check out and then they staff to get all rooms cleaned then by 3 pm check in. They need time to clean the rooms.

Why do hotels not let you check-in until 3?

The 3 PM rule came to play a long time ago, when housekeeping services weren't as efficient as they are today, so the gap between guests leaving and checking-in had to be reasonable. Imagine a hotel in high level occupancy with understaffed cleaning crews and a long line at the front desk.

What is the 24 hour rule for hotels?

Under hotel policy, guests at a residential hotel may stay at the hotel for months or years at a time so long as they leave their unit for 24 hours every 28 days.
